How many miles will a 2020 Subaru Ascent last?

Mileage Expectations for a 2020 Subaru Ascent
The mileage expectations for a 2020 Subaru Ascent can vary based on several factors, including maintenance, driving habits, and road conditions. However, based on available information, it’s possible to provide some insights into the potential mileage performance of this vehicle.
Longevity and Mileage:
– The Subaru Ascent has been reported to perform well over high mileage, with some owners reaching impressive figures. For example, one owner reported driving their 2019 Ascent Touring for 123,000 miles without major issues, while another Ascent used for medical transport was bought back by Subaru at 300,000 miles, with no major issues except for the need for new bushings at the 250,000-mile mark.
– Some owners have reported reaching 300,000 miles with their Subaru vehicles, particularly the Outback and Forester models, and it’s expected that the Ascent would perform similarly. However, achieving such high mileage requires meticulous maintenance and should not necessarily be expected.
Maintenance Considerations:
– Regular maintenance and careful driving habits can contribute to the longevity of the Subaru Ascent. For instance, the brakes of a Subaru Ascent are expected to be good for use for up to 47,500 miles, or up to 3 years based on 15,000 miles driven annually. Additionally, with normal use and regular inspection and maintenance, the stock tires of the Subaru Ascent can be used for up to 60,000 miles, or up to 4 years based on 15,000 miles driven annually.
Reliability and Issues:
– It’s important to note that some 2020 Subaru Ascent models have been affected by reliability issues, including defective windshields, which led to a class-action lawsuit. The 2020 Ascent has also accumulated NHTSA complaints and a recall, indicating potential issues with this model.

What is the reliability of the Subaru Ascent?

The 2023 Subaru Ascent has a predicted reliability score of 81 out of 100. A J.D. Power predicted reliability score of 91-100 is considered the Best, 81-90 is Great, 70-80 is Average and 0-69 is Fair and considered below average.

How many miles can Subaru Ascent go?

How Many Miles Does the Subaru Ascent Last? The Subaru Ascent is a robust and reliable SUV, estimated to last 200,000 to 250,000 miles. This means approximately 13-17 years of service, assuming an average mileage of 15,000 per year.

Why is the Subaru Ascent rated so low?

According to Car complaints, the 2019 Ascent had three primary issues, an open tailgate that drains battery life, a windshield prone to cracks, and the SUV failing to start. Consumer Reports also noted that the three-row SUV required two separate service campaigns to address suspension and climate system problems.

What are the downsides of a Subaru Ascent?

A list of some of the most common issues Ascent owners have to deal with.

  • Denso Fuel Pump Failure. The impellers inside of Denso branded fuel pumps may have been excessively exposed to a drying agent during manufacturing.
  • CAN System Parasitic Drain on the Battery.
  • Cracked Windshields.
  • Subaru EyeSight Problems.

How much does a 2020 Subaru Ascent cost new?

The price of the 2020 Subaru Ascent starts at $33,005 and goes up to $46,055 depending on the trim and options. Every Ascent features the same engine and transmission that powers the standard all-wheel-drive system, which means choosing which Ascent to buy is decided by available features.
